LockTime in Electrum wallet is referring to the
nLockTime
field of the transaction. The base protocol dictates that the transaction cannot be included in a block until nLockTime
. So this sets a timelock on the TRANSACTION not on the UTXO. To set a timelock on a UTXO, you need use either CLTV (BIP65) or CSV (BIP112).I'm excited for MiniScript adoption as it can make it easier to create and share advanced timelock scripts.
